Man, I was in a bit of a panic with it overheating and the vacation just a few days away. I was on the fence with pulling it to the marine tech (major $$$$) or just leaving the boat behind. I'm psyched it was a freebee no big deal issue:D

So what did I learn on that?

I think, maybe, when I put the muffs on the engine, then turned on the water, I must have introduced air into the system (maybe).

When I jumped on iboats yesterday I found a thread that kinda talked about that happening. Wierd that I hadn't had that issue previously:confused:

Anyhow, I shot that video yesterday so here's me in confusion/nervous mode...

Well, I don't know, but running it in the big tub did the trick. Ran for about 30 minutes no issues;)

Boat looks just fantastic, awesome job Jason, I had the same overheating issue with a 90 Evinrude overheating with muffs on, then put it in a tub of water and it ran fine, maybe just not enough constant water flow

Adding a telltale would help in a catching a potential overheat before it happens. I clamp muffs on my motor's leg, so all water goes into the water pump....and NOT onto the ground.
